Pyrolysis and Gasification of Orinoco Tar and Orimulsion.

open access: yesJournal of the Japan Institute of Energy, 1996
The deposits of Orinoco tar in Venezuela are estimated to amount to 80 percent of the deposits of crude oil in the Middle East. To examine the possibility for utilizing the Orinoco tar as chemical feedstocks, pyrolysis behavior of Orinoco tar and Orinoco tar-water emulsion (Orimulsion) was examined using a Curie point pyro-lyzer (CPP) and an entrained ...
